diff --git a/package-managers/ame.yaml b/package-managers/pacman.yaml similarity index 85% rename from package-managers/ame.yaml rename to package-managers/pacman.yaml index 0215b95..7f5e4c8 100644 --- a/package-managers/ame.yaml +++ b/package-managers/pacman.yaml @@ -1,5 +1,5 @@ -name: ame -needsudo: false +name: pacman +needsudo: true cmdautoremove: -Yc cmdclean: -Sc cmdinstall: -S diff --git a/package-managers/swupd.yaml b/package-managers/swupd.yaml new file mode 100644 index 0000000..d2ab1a6 --- /dev/null +++ b/package-managers/swupd.yaml @@ -0,0 +1,13 @@ +name: swupd +needsudo: true +cmdautoremove: bundle-remove --orphans +cmdclean: clean +cmdinstall: bundle-add +cmdlist: bundle-list --status +cmdpurge: bundle-remove -R +cmdremove: bundle-remove +cmdsearch: search +cmdshow: bundle-info +cmdupdate: check-update +cmdupgrade: update +builtin: true diff --git a/package-managers/xbps.yaml b/package-managers/xbps.yaml new file mode 100644 index 0000000..f7d79e3 --- /dev/null +++ b/package-managers/xbps.yaml @@ -0,0 +1,13 @@ +name: sh +needsudo: true +cmdautoremove: -c "xbps-remove -oO" +cmdclean: -c "xbps-remove -O" +cmdinstall: -c "xbps-install -S" +cmdlist: -c "xbps-query -l" +cmdpurge: -c "xbps-remove -R" +cmdremove: -c "xbps-remove" +cmdsearch: -c "xbps-query -Rs" +cmdshow: -c "xbps-query -RS" +cmdupdate: -c "xbps-install -Su" +cmdupgrade: -c "xbps-install -Su" +builtin: true diff --git a/stacks/arch.yaml b/stacks/arch.yaml new file mode 100644 index 0000000..8e0dbd6 --- /dev/null +++ b/stacks/arch.yaml @@ -0,0 +1,5 @@ +name: arch linux +base: docker.io/library/archlinux:latest +packages: [] +pkgmanager: pacman +builtin: true diff --git a/stacks/crystal-linux.yaml b/stacks/crystal-linux.yaml deleted file mode 100644 index d004416..0000000 --- a/stacks/crystal-linux.yaml +++ /dev/null @@ -1,5 +0,0 @@ -name: crystal-linux -base: registry.getcryst.al/crystal/misc/docker:latest -packages: [] -pkgmanager: ame -builtin: true diff --git a/stacks/debian-dev.yaml b/stacks/debian-dev.yaml new file mode 100644 index 0000000..c9b4db8 --- /dev/null +++ b/stacks/debian-dev.yaml @@ -0,0 +1,5 @@ +name: debian sid +base: debian:sid +packages: [] +pkgmanager: apt +builtin: true diff --git a/stacks/debian.yaml b/stacks/debian.yaml new file mode 100644 index 0000000..3c74b81 --- /dev/null +++ b/stacks/debian.yaml @@ -0,0 +1,5 @@ +name: debian stable +base: debian:stable +packages: [] +pkgmanager: apt +builtin: true diff --git a/stacks/fedora-dev.yaml b/stacks/fedora-dev.yaml new file mode 100644 index 0000000..561074f --- /dev/null +++ b/stacks/fedora-dev.yaml @@ -0,0 +1,5 @@ +name: fedora rawhide +base: fedora:latest +packages: [] +pkgmanager: dnf +builtin: true diff --git a/stacks/fedora.yaml b/stacks/fedora.yaml index e143717..9bfe248 100644 --- a/stacks/fedora.yaml +++ b/stacks/fedora.yaml @@ -1,4 +1,4 @@ -name: fedora +name: fedora workstation base: fedora:latest packages: [] pkgmanager: dnf diff --git a/stacks/pika.yaml b/stacks/pika.yaml new file mode 100644 index 0000000..0305af6 --- /dev/null +++ b/stacks/pika.yaml @@ -0,0 +1,5 @@ +name: pika os +base: ghcr.io/pikaos-linux/pika-package-container:latest +packages: [] +pkgmanager: apt +builtin: true diff --git a/stacks/ubuntu-dev.yaml b/stacks/ubuntu-dev.yaml new file mode 100644 index 0000000..c9c050a --- /dev/null +++ b/stacks/ubuntu-dev.yaml @@ -0,0 +1,5 @@ +name: ubuntu latest +base: ubuntu:rolling +packages: [] +pkgmanager: apt +builtin: true diff --git a/stacks/ubuntu.yaml b/stacks/ubuntu.yaml index a76fbab..533cd56 100644 --- a/stacks/ubuntu.yaml +++ b/stacks/ubuntu.yaml @@ -1,4 +1,4 @@ -name: ubuntu +name: ubuntu lts base: ubuntu:latest packages: [] pkgmanager: apt diff --git a/stacks/void.yaml b/stacks/void.yaml new file mode 100644 index 0000000..e14ed16 --- /dev/null +++ b/stacks/void.yaml @@ -0,0 +1,5 @@ +name: void linux +base: ghcr.io/void-linux/void-linux:latest-full-x86_64 +packages: [] +pkgmanager: xbps +builtin: true